Explain the support reaction? What are different types of support and their reactions?
Sol.: When the numbers of forces are acting on a body, and the body is supported on the other body, then the second body exerts a force known as reaction on the first body at the points of contact so that the first body is in equilibrium. The second body is called as support and the force exerted by the second body on first body is called as support reaction.
There are three types of support;
1. Roller support
2. Hinged Support
3. Fixed Support
Roller Support: Beams end is supported on the rollers. Reaction is at the right angle. Roller can be treated as frictionless. At the roller support only one vertical reaction
